Wastewater Treatment Technician

Madison, MS 39110

Posted: 12/13/2022 Employment Type: Temp-to-Hire Job Category: Industrial Job Number: 3633 Pay Rate: 17.00

Job Description

Description of Work:       - Ensure the proper operation of the wastewater treatment system to meet production   and regulatory requirements.   - Maintain proper levels of wastewater treatment chemicals and supplies   to properly operate the wastewater treatment system. - Maintain appropriate wastewater storage tank levels to facilitate proper e-coat   system/stages dump schedule.   - Maintain assigned area sanitation and chemical organization to the expected standard. - Unload, receive and store all received chemicals within the stated guidelines. - Maintain Wastewater equipment   - Maintain reporting documentation in accordance with SEC and state DEQ guidelines. - Perform routine operational/maintenance tasks and assist maintenance mechanics when required. - Any other tasks assigned               Key Performance Measures:       Safety Zero Recordable Incidents, Participant in "Always Safe Way of Life"     Zero Recordable Incidents in Wastewater Treatment Area   Service 100% Compliance to E-Coat Line Dump Schedule     Wastewater Treatment at 95% of Target Discharge Rate, Annualized   Quality Zero "out of compliance" issues with DEQ     100% Environmental Compliance   Cost Chemical usage at or below target spending levels   Team A Gold Member of the Cost Reduction Structure           Job Requirements:       - Ability to read and interpret gauges, directions, signage and handle dangerous chemicals - Ability to complete math analysis and control charts - Ability to execute the duties of the job and meet all KPMs and regulatory   laws and guidelines.     - Maintains work area and grounds within all sanitation, housekeeping, environmental   and safety expectations.     - Ability to perform as a Team member, within a Team environment - Ability to work as a cohesive unit with Lab Tenders - Ability to carry and lift 75 pounds and become a certified forklift operator
